Design and Development Phase
|
RMA and Safety considerations are
often neglected early in a program lifecycle. This
can often become a costly mistake. Reliability and
safety are always part of a program requirement and
the earlier we consider them and take them into
account the cheaper it is for us to implement them
successfully.
As early as specifications,
requirements, and SOW interpretation, SoHaR will
assist you with:
-
Development
of
RMA and Safety plans
-
Review of
requirements documentation and test plans
-
Reliability & Maintainability: R&M Allocation
based on top level requirements and
specifications; R&M Prediction based on design and
field data; Design Analysis and optimization of
RMA metrics
-
Functional
safety and hazard analyses
-
Fault Tree Analysis
-
Failure
Modes and Effects Analysis (Process
and Design FMEA)/
Failure Modes and Effects Criticality Analysis
(FMECA)
-
Cost-Effectiveness and Trade-Off analyses:
Modeling, prediction, and financial analysis to
determine the most cost effective options for
reliability, sparing, training, response time, and
other support resources.
-
Life Cycle Cost: Prediction of life cycle
costs from R&D phase through operational and
phase-out phases.
-
Optimal
Repair Level Analysis (ORLA/LORA): Determining the
best maintenance and repair concepts to support
the operational phases.
-
Participation in design reviews at the hardware,
software, and system levels.
